Item# 5 DISCRETIONARY FUNDING FROM SENATOR BARBARA BOXER
Staff has been contacted by Senator Boxer's office and been made aware of some
possible discretionary funding opportunities to the City of Lynwood. They are
asking that Council submit requests before the 9~h of February.
Chief Administrative Officer Davis explained to Council he would like to input the
Council Items to Senator Boxer.
President Richards stated he would like to proceed with the Language Institute for
the residents of Lynwood.
Member Byrd stated he would also like to proceed with the Fitness Center.
Member Reyes discussed adding a computerize program to the list.
Chief Administrative Officer Davis stated he is going to work on upgrading the
Language Institute Program, and also stated he would take all of Councils
suggestions and concerns.
It was moved by Vice President Sanchez, seconded by Member Reyes to allow
-~- staff to negotiate with Barbara Boxer.
